The URIs are stateful! You can always use the same link to recreate the exact parameters.
Specifically, the URI is a Base-64 encoded query string of what is loaded asynchronously.
Therefore,
http://ssarherps.org/cndb/#YmF0cmFjaG9zZXBzJmxvb3NlPXRydWU
has the query string reconstructed from the bit after the hash:
Base64.decode("YmF0cmFjaG9zZXBzJmxvb3NlPXRydWU")
// returns "batrachoseps&loose=true"You can generate links that way, corresponding to the options given in the following API section.

Please note that all entries are returned in lower case, except
for result.[taxon].notes and result.[taxon].image (where an
image exists and the path includes mixed case).
As the rest of the data have strict formatting requirements, all other formatting is left up to the application to correctly apply CSS styles to generate the desired case.

The search algorithm behaves as follows:
-
If the search
is_numeric(), aloosesearch is done against theauthority_yearcolumn in the database. The returnedmethodwith the JSON isauthority_year. The search is then checked for the absence of the space character. If no overrides are set,
common_name,genus,species,subspecies,major_common_type,major_subtype, anddeprecated_scientificcolumns are all searched. The returnedmethodisspaceless_search. The search is then checked for spaces.
-
If a
filteris set (with the requiredboolean_typeparameter):-
If there is two or three words, the first word is checked against the
genuscolumn, second against thespeciescolumn, and third against thesubspeciescolumn. The returnedmethodisscientific. If the above returns no results, the
deprecated_scientificcolumn is checked. At the time of this writing, there are no entries in this column and this check will always fail. The returned method isdeprecated_scientific. -
If the above returns no results, the
common_namecolumn is checked. The returned method isno_scientific_common. If the
filterparameter isn't specified, the above scientific and deprecated scientific searches are executed with "best-guess" boolean types (with returnedmethodsscientific_rawanddeprecated_scientific_raw). If all these fail, and
fuzzyisfalse, thefallbackflag is set and a search is done againstcommon_name. The returnedmethodisspace_common_fallback. If the
fuzzyflag is set, or the above still gives no results and thelooseflag is set, a search is done word-wise oncommon_name,major_common_type, andmajor_subtype(eg, for all matches that contain each word as a substring in any of the columns). The returnedmethodisspace_loose_fallback. You can access the administration / editing interface by logging in at http://ssarherps.org/cndb/admin
If you create a user, an exisiting user with the admin flag set will need to authorize your access. You will not be able to log in or access the admin interface until this occurs.
If you log in to another device / location, all other session credentials will be invalidated. This occurs at API-level, and may require a re-login if your network location changes.
Old scientific names are to be stored in the field Deprecated Scientific Names. This field has a rigid required structure. They're written as a JSON entry with special requirements (and no braces).
Therefore, each deprecated scientific name is to be written as "Genus species":"Authority: YYYY", with an arbitrarily long list of those separated by commas. Therefore, be cognizant of the following rules:
-
There should be no space between colons or commas. E.g.,
"foo":"bar"and"foo:bar","bar":"baz"is OK, but not"foo" :"bar","bar":"baz"or"foo":"bar", "bar":"baz". -
The
"Authority: YEAR"string is optional in the space around the colon. The year has to match the rules established in Issue #37 -
The validity of the taxon information is not checked.
